IOWA CITY, Iowa — The University of Iowa baseball team is set to host No. 5 Oregon in its final conference home series of the season this week at Duane Banks Field, and a large crowd is expected as the Hawkeyes vie for a Big Ten regular season title.

To ensure the best possible experience, fans are strongly encouraged to purchase tickets in advance online at hawkeyesports.com/tickets. Ordering online helps avoid long lines at the gate and reduces the risk of missing out in what could be a sold-out environment.

Please note Saturday’s noon game, which coincides with the university’s graduation ceremonies at Carver-Hawkeye Arena, will create additional traffic and parking challenges. University lots 75S and 43NW will be dedicated to free parking for those attending the baseball game. In addition, Lot 43W, 73, 49, 53 and Mrytle lots are available and free of charge.

Also note that Saturday’s Senior Day recognition will occur prior to the contest and fans will be arriving early.

Important Game Day Enhancements and Information:

Due to the anticipated high attendance, the following additions and adjustments will be in place:

Expanded Seating: Temporary bleachers have been added down the third base line, providing up to 450 additional seats.

Additional Restrooms: Extra porta-potties will be available behind the grandstands and near the auxiliary bleachers along the third base line.

Enhanced Concessions: Aramark will offer expanded points of sale and food options inside the pavilion.

Increased Staffing: Additional personnel will be on-site to assist both inside the stadium and with traffic management before and after the game.
